front axle????

I noticed some grease on the drivers side of my front axle pumpkin. The boots look in good shape. The four wheel drive works fine also. Is this a common thing to see?

Re: front axle????

the big clamp is probably loose i would get a universal clamp from a jobber (napa, auto zone etc.) and some grease. remove the old clamp, slide the boot back add some grease and install the new clamp. should be alright. if you leave it the way it is dirt and moisture will eventually wreck the axle.
